Waste-to-Energy Technologies



With waste generation increasing, locating sustainable remedies is ending up being increasingly important. Waste-to-Energy (WtE) innovations supply an encouraging technique to managing our waste while creating power. These technologies involve transforming non-recyclable waste products right into useful kinds of power like electricity, heat, or fuel.



By drawing away waste from land fills and incinerating it in controlled settings, WtE not only lowers the volume of waste however also creates beneficial energy resources.

One usual approach of WtE is mass-burn incineration, where waste is melted at high temperatures to produce heavy steam that drives turbines creating electrical energy. One more strategy is gasification, which transforms waste into artificial gas that can be utilized for power generation or as a chemical feedstock.

In addition, anaerobic food digestion breaks down organic waste to produce biogas for power.

Executing WtE innovations can help reduce greenhouse gas emissions, decrease reliance on nonrenewable fuel sources, and minimize the ecological influence of waste disposal.
